*** no onward chain *** Situated on Christys Lane, within easy walking distance of both local schools and Shaftesbury town centre, this well-proportioned three-bedroom home has been recently modernised throughout to a high standard and offers versatile accommodation together with a particularly enjoyable, low-maintenance garden and useful converted garage.
The ground floor provides a welcoming entrance hall leading into the generous kitchen/dining room, which measures approximately 31ft in length and provides excellent space for both everyday family life and entertaining. The kitchen offers sleek worktops with ample storage and integrated appliances with room for a dining table and additional furniture. To the right of the entrance hall doors lead through to the sitting room, a comfortable reception space with a feature fireplace and pleasant outlook over the garden. A cloakroom completes the ground floor accommodation.
Upstairs, there are three bedrooms, including two well-proportioned double bedrooms, alongside a smaller third bedroom which would also make an ideal child's bedroom, dressing room or study. The family shower room is conveniently positioned off the landing.
Outside, the garden has been thoughtfully designed for ease of maintenance and entertaining, being predominantly laid to patio. Steps lead up to a raised patio area, creating different levels and seating spaces, while mature shrubs provide a good degree of greenery and privacy. A particularly appealing feature is the garden bar, providing an ideal setting for entertaining friends and family during the warmer months.
The former garage has been converted to create a versatile additional space, currently used as an office. This could equally lend itself to use as a home gym, studio, hobby room or additional workspace, depending on the purchaser's requirements.
The property is ideally positioned for those wanting convenient access to Shaftesbury's amenities, with the town centre, local schools, shops and everyday facilities all within a short walk.
